Beginning today the lower parking lot at Sandy Neck Beach in Barnstable will be closed as construction gets underway on a long-term coastal resiliency project.
Part of the upper parking lot near the bathhouse will also be blocked off during the construction hours of 7 a.m. until 4 p.m. Mondays through Fridays, and the bathhouse will also be closed.
After the work hours, the upper lot and bathhouse will be open. The town says the off-road vehicle entrance trail, marsh trail and gatehouse will remain open during the first phase.
The project is expected to be completed by the summer of 2026.
